Trait genius

Genius is a mental trait in The Sims 3. It is first available at birth. It actually conflicts with the Stupid trait, but that trait was scrapped due to its similarity to the Absent-Minded trait.

Geniuses are logical thinkers, masters of chess and excellent hackers. They savor pursuits of the mind.

Behavior

  • Geniuses will learn the Logic skill 30% faster than other Sims.
  • Geniuses enjoy playing chess and will improve at it quickly.
  • Geniuses learn Mooch, Chess, Hacking, and Dominoes[TS3:ST] hidden skills 30% faster.
  • When a Sim in the household dies Genius Sims can "Play Chess for (Sim Name)'s life."
  • Sim can solve crazy mathematical problems on the computer for cash.
  • Geniuses will do better at Law Enforcement, Science and Medical careers.
  • Geniuses will autonomously "Contemplate" their surroundings. This may sometimes incur the Fascinated moodlet for 3 hours.
  • Geniuses can create pixelized paintings using Paint Stylized Still-Life.
  • Geniuses can initiate "Deep Conversations" at any point in a relationship and they enjoy them more.
  • Provides a bonus to Sims writing in the Science Fiction genre.
  • Provides a bonus to Sims writing in the Mystery genre.
  • NPCs with this trait are attracted to the following lot assignments: Library.
  • Toddlers with this trait will learn their toddler skills faster than other Sims.

Possible Lifetime Wishes

  • Chess Legend
  • Perfect Mind/Perfect Body
  • Renaissance Sim
  • The Tinkerer
